Web16 jun. 2024 · Australia's Paris Agreement commitment will now be to reduce emissions by 43 per cent by 2030, and to net zero emissions by 2050. The previous government had refused to raise its ambitions above a 28 per cent 2030 target, which it set in 2015 ⁠— it signed on to a net zero target at the UN's climate conference last year. princess karmel twitter https://airtech-ae.com
